The contract requires comprehensive field surveys to locate both underground and overhead utilities within a statewide area, with the goal of identifying potential conflicts before construction begins. This includes mapping utility locations with precision, creating conflict matrices that outline intersections between proposed project work and existing infrastructure, and actively coordinating with utility owners to resolve any identified issues. The work must ensure that all utility conflicts are addressed in advance to prevent delays, safety hazards, or costly redesigns during construction. The task is classified as a subcontract under NAICS code 541370, indicating it falls under engineering services, and is administered by the Maryland Department of Transportation. All activities are to be performed across the entire state, with no specific city or region designated as the sole place of performance. The solicitation was posted on August 20, 2026, with the same date set as the response deadline, suggesting an immediate or expedited procurement process. The contract emphasizes collaboration with utility providers and demands thorough documentation to support safe, efficient project execution.
